A BILL
To ensure that any individual serving as Director of National
Intelligence in an acting capacity possesses the qualifications
required of the Director of National Intelligence to have extensive
national security expertise, and for other purposes.
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the
United States of America in Congress assembled,
SECTION 1. SHORT TITLE.
This Act may be cited as the ``Minimum Experience Requirements for
Intelligence Transition Act of 2026'' or the ``MERIT Act of 2026''.
SEC. 2. EXPERTISE OF ACTING DIRECTOR OF NATIONAL INTELLIGENCE.
Section 102(a) of the National Security Act of 1947 (50 U.S.C.
3023(a)) is amended, in the second sentence, by inserting ``or serving
as Director of National Intelligence in an acting capacity, including
any official performing the duties of such position,'' before ``shall
have''.
